NEW YORK (AP) - A homeless man has been struck and killed by a New York City subway train.

The Daily News reports that the man was killed by an R train at the Court Street station in Brooklyn around 4 a.m. Friday. He was not immediately identified.

The man was removed from the tracks and normal service was restored before the morning rush hour.
